#11b347 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11b347 is composed of 6.7% red, 70.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#11b347 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ff8e with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#11b347 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11b347 has RGB values of R:17, G:179,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1160007.

Hex triplet 11b347 #11b347
RGB Decimal 17, 179, 71 rgb(17,179,71)
RGB Percent 6.7, 70.2, 27.8 rgb(6.7%,70.2%,27.8%)
CMYK 91, 0, 60, 30
HSL 140°, 82.7, 38.4 hsl(140,82.7%,38.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 140°, 90.5, 70.2
Web Safe 00cc33 #00cc33
CIE-LAB 64.009, -60.485, 43.758
XYZ 17.487, 32.812, 11.373
xyY 0.284, 0.532, 32.812
CIE-LCH 64.009, 74.654, 144.116
CIE-LUV 64.009, -57.587, 62.179
Hunter-Lab 57.282, -45.75, 28.326
Binary 00010001, 10110011, 01000111

Shades and Tints of #11b347

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021207 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
